General annotation (Comments)
| Function | Subunits I and II form the functional core of the enzyme complex. Electrons originating in cytochrome c are transferred via heme a and Cu(A) to the binuclear center formed by heme a3 and Cu(B) By similarity. |
| Catalytic activity | 4 ferrocytochrome c + O2 + 4 H+ = 4 ferricytochrome c + 2 H2O. |
| Cofactor | Copper A By similarity. Heme group By similarity. |
| Subcellular location | Cell membrane; Multi-pass membrane protein Potential. |
| Sequence similarities | Belongs to the cytochrome c oxidase subunit 2 family. Contains 1 RPE1 insert domain. |
